"class Website:\n",
" def __init__(self, url, headless=True, chrome_binary=None, wait_seconds=10):\n",
" \"\"\"\n",
" Create this Website object from the given url using Selenium WebDriver.\n",
" Uses webdriver-manager to fetch a compatible chromedriver automatically.\n",
" Parameters:\n",
" - url: target URL\n",
" - headless: run chrome headless (True/False)\n",
" - chrome_binary: optional path to chrome/chromium binary (if not in PATH)\n",
" - wait_seconds: timeout for waiting page load/dynamic content\n",
" \"\"\"\n",
" self.url = url\n",
" options = Options()\n",
"\n",
" # headless or visible browser\n",
" if headless:\n",
" options.add_argument(\"--headless=new\") # use new headless flag where supported\n",
" options.add_argument(\"--no-sandbox\")\n",
" options.add_argument(\"--disable-dev-shm-usage\") # helpful in containers\n",
" options.add_argument(\"--disable-gpu\")\n",
" # some sites detect automation; these flags may help\n",
" options.add_argument(\"--disable-blink-features=AutomationControlled\")\n",
" options.add_experimental_option(\"excludeSwitches\", [\"enable-automation\"])\n",
" options.add_experimental_option('useAutomationExtension', False)\n",
"\n",
" # If you need to point to a custom Chrome/Chromium binary:\n",
" if chrome_binary:\n",
" options.binary_location = chrome_binary\n",
"\n",
" # Use webdriver-manager to download/manage chromedriver automatically\n",
" service = Service(ChromeDriverManager().install())\n",
"\n",
" driver = webdriver.Chrome(service=service, options=options)\n",
" try:\n",
" driver.get(url)\n",
"\n",
" # Use WebDriverWait to let dynamic JS content load (better than sleep)\n",
" try:\n",
" WebDriverWait(driver, wait_seconds).until(\n",
" lambda d: d.execute_script(\"return document.readyState === 'complete'\")\n",
" )\n",
" except Exception:\n",
" # fallback: short sleep if readyState didn't hit complete in time\n",
" time.sleep(2)\n",
"\n",
" html = driver.page_source\n",
" soup = BeautifulSoup(html, \"html.parser\")\n",
"\n",
" # Title\n",
" self.title = soup.title.string if soup.title else \"No title found\"\n",
"\n",
" # Remove irrelevant tags inside body if body exists\n",
" body = soup.body or soup\n",
" for irrelevant in body([\"script\", \"style\", \"img\", \"input\"]):\n",
" irrelevant.decompose()\n",
"\n",
" self.text = body.get_text(separator=\"\\n\", strip=True)\n",
"\n",
" finally:\n",
" driver.quit()\n",
